Second parliamentary elections since 2019 concluded in Cezayir, eyes on results

The voting process has been completed across the country for the second parliamentary elections held in Cezayir following the 2019 popular movement (Hirak). Citizens had gone to the polls to determine the 407 deputies who will serve in the new term, replacing the assembly that came to office in an early election in November 2019. These elections are considered the second major test of the political transformation created by the massive protests of 2019 in Cezayir's political history, and their role in reshaping the political atmosphere is widely debated. Counting of votes cast under security measures has begun at tens of thousands of polling stations across the country. Voter turnout and vote distribution are among the most critical data closely monitored by political parties and observers.

Although the first signs of unofficial results have begun to emerge immediately after the closing of the polls, the completion of the counting and evaluation process is awaited for the definitive results.
